Family-Friendly Diveagar 4-Day Itinerary

Friday, September 29: Arrival and Beach Exploration

Start your Diveagar adventure by arriving at your hotel and settling in. In the morning, head to Diveagar Beach, a picturesque stretch of coastline known for its golden sand and clear waters. Enjoy a leisurely walk along the shore, build sandcastles, or simply relax and soak up the sun. In the afternoon, take a boat ride to the nearby Suvarna Ganesh Temple, located in the middle of the sea. Marvel at the temple's unique architecture and seek blessings. As the evening approaches, visit Harihareshwar Beach for a mesmerizing sunset experience.

  • Diveagar Beach: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Suvarna Ganesh Temple: Boat ride cost - INR 200 per person, 1 hour
  • Harihareshwar Beach: Free, 1-2 hours
Saturday, September 30: Historical Exploration

Embark on a historical journey in Diveagar. Start your day by visiting the fascinating Murud-Janjira Fort. This ancient fort is located on an island and offers panoramic views of the Arabian Sea. Explore the fort's intricate architecture and learn about its intriguing history. In the afternoon, visit the Phansad Wildlife Sanctuary, a haven for nature enthusiasts. Take a safari tour, spot diverse wildlife, and enjoy the serene surroundings. As the evening sets in, head to the Karmarkar Museum to witness beautiful sculptures crafted by local artists.

  • Murud-Janjira Fort: Entry fee - INR 40 per person, 2-3 hours
  • Phansad Wildlife Sanctuary: Entry fee - INR 100 per person, Safari cost - INR 500 per person, 3-4 hours
  • Karmarkar Museum: Entry fee - INR 50 per person, 1-2 hours
Sunday, October 1: Village Exploration

Immerse yourself in the local culture and charm of Diveagar's villages. Start your day by visiting the quaint Shrivardhan Village, known for its tranquil vibe and beautiful temples. Explore the ancient Shrivardhan Beach and enjoy a peaceful stroll. In the afternoon, head to the nearby Velas Village, famous for its turtle conservation efforts. If you're visiting during the right season, you might even witness baby turtles being released into the sea. As the evening approaches, experience the rural lifestyle by exploring the nearby homestays and enjoying traditional Maharashtrian cuisine.

  • Shrivardhan Village: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Velas Village: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Homestay Experience: Cost varies, 1-2 hours

Monday, October 2: Water Sports and Departure

Make the most of your last day in Diveagar by indulging in thrilling water sports. Head to the Diveagar Water Sports Complex and choose from a variety of activities such as jet skiing, banana boat rides, and parasailing. Enjoy the adrenaline rush and create unforgettable memories. In the afternoon, take a peaceful stroll along the serene Bharad Khol Beach and soak in the tranquil atmosphere. Bid farewell to Diveagar with a heart full of amazing experiences and depart for your onward journey.

  • Diveagar Water Sports Complex: Activity costs vary, 2-3 hours
  • Bharad Khol Beach: Free, 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Diveagar, don't miss out on exploring the nearby beach town of Shrivardhan, known for its pristine beaches and ancient temples. Additionally, the nearby town of Harihareshwar offers a peaceful atmosphere and is home to the Harihareshwar Temple, a popular pilgrimage site. Both destinations are family-friendly and provide opportunities to connect with nature and experience local culture.
